      I'm wondering why jboss does not support IIOP as a communication protocol.
      I don't think there is any technical reason that prevent this. Even if jboss creators don't want to go throu the CORBA skeleton and stub class creation (so to mantain the deploy process easy), jboss could always support CORBA via the dynamic invocation interface and the dynamic invocation skeleton.
      So what are exactly the reasons? And beside isn't RMI/IIOP mandatory to achieve the j2ee certification?
